Output 3feb389069c99351b24bf6fb418bcbd09d0b95d3feea02b5c03a6f73f4bc4bf1:5

value
9565938
script pubkey
OP_0 OP_PUSHBYTES_20 87e6809242985c88e4ad5e518de2a0e44d5638ae
address
tb1qslngpyjznpwg3e9dtegcmc4qu3x4vw9wmtzx73
transaction
3feb389069c99351b24bf6fb418bcbd09d0b95d3feea02b5c03a6f73f4bc4bf1
spent
true